In 1999, Honda changed the game and broke the drought of sport ATV's when they released the legendary TRX 400EX. While most machines need a couple years to iron out the flaws, Honda and the rest of the world knew they had a winner in this quad after it not only conquered the Baja 1000, but won. Since then this quad hasn't had any major changes except for an added reverse gear and body redesign in 2005 and again in 2008. With so many of these machines out there you have a ton of options in the aftermarket and in this video we show you everything that we added to this machine to give you some of the ideas of what you can do to your TRX 400EX to really make it your own.

Suspension is super important on a 400ex if you want to go fast because of the lack of power. If you have a suspension that can soak up the bumps it allows you to keep it pinned more often instead of letting off and struggling to get back up to speed. I personally ran Lonestar long travel a-arma with elke stage 4 shocks front and back with a Lonestar rear axle. Its been a good while since I had mine so I dont even know what is available. CT Racing 426 kit with stage 1 cam and the older 450r fcr carb was an amazing combination with the suspension because you had the power of a LIGHTLY modded 450, and if you had your whits about you then you could run them down on an XC race. Like I said, suspension is still key so you can crash through the rough stuff and spend less time trying to accelerate because the 450's will definitely do that better. Do those mods with a good steering stablizer, nerf bars or at least heel guards, and frame, a arm, and swing arm protection and you can be a very competitive racer. Oil cooling is another important thing to think about, and I also ran aluminum scoops to funnle more air to the engine because its air cooled. As far as intakes and exhause I ran a white bros exhaust and I experimented with various foam filters and had good success. Tires I liked the Maxxis gncc tires and to save a little cash I ran reinforced rims in the back and bead locks up front with tireballs in front and rear to prevent flats. It was a great machine, not the most powerful, but very competitive and lots of fun for all levels of racers/riders. In all I did have about $10,000 in the machin, which included $2,800 for the cost of buying the machine itself. Maybe I should have gotten a 450, but either way I had a good time and that is what is most important at the end of the day.

it is sporting the Sideways Utility type engine .. they are quite torquey .. by the engine design and are also simple to replace the topend on .. if ever needed .. they are quite reliable .. the best advice i can give is to annually or by annually .. check the rear differential fluid .. and if you like to get muddy .. make sure the small hose running from the rear differential to the air box .. is connected and intact.. ( im sure these are fine now .. but eventually the rubber line will get brittle and if it is off and you go in deep water,, the water will enter through the vent hole and the diff lube will float out on top . . a new differential is quite pricey 500 or more .. if 10 years from now the worst happens .. rebuild the differential before the axle play gets crazy and .. it can be a inexpensive fix .. bearing and seal kits are under 100.. .. lots of folks ride until the quad will not .. by then the diff housing is garbage.

TRX450r front shocks are too stiff on the 400 unless you are a Big guy (200+ lbs) . Front Resivor shocks from a Kawasaki 400 or 450 ( 2008+ ) work great with out re valving them and Yamaha YFZ 450R front shocks work well .. ( they require some mild grinding to narrow the upper mount like the TRX450 ones .. and need to be old enough that they are not too tall I think the change happened in 2013/2014 ?? but am not 100% sure .. ( i currently have fox podiums all around pulled from a Polaris Predator along with custom mounting brackets and +2" houser arms.. Another nice mod is braded brake lines in the front and a pair of dual piston front calipers they fit direct from the 450r or all the other major competitors Yamaha , Kawasaki , Suzuki ..
